The recommended temperature for hot water stored within a storage water heater such as Gas or Electric Storage Tank, Solar Storage Tank, or Heat Pump system should be between 60-65 degrees Celsius. Ten degrees can be the difference between a safe contact time with hot water and third-degree burns.
